Fair Trade Cafe

A coffee shop and pastry store with two locations in downtown Phoenix.

Review

 

It is a good sign when a café is still humming with customers on a late Wednesday morning. It is an idyllic café if there are quaint apartments sitting just above the building. But, you know you’ve found a gem when it appears the café has frequent customers, camped out on their computer or conversing with friends. Fair Trade Café has all of this.

 

Located just off the light rail, this coffee establishment is easy to reach and owned by locals who like to serve up what they call “coffee with a conscience”. So, not only will drinking a cup of their coffee get you feeling good as the caffeine courses through your veins, but will also make you feel like a better person, knowing that the morning brew you just downed is fair trade-certified, organic and ecologically sustainable.

 

With locally-sourced coffee as the staple of their menu, at Fair Trade you can get a simple drip coffee or an espresso drink. Beyond coffee, you will also find tea, smoothies, breakfast, lunch and pastries (including vegan and gluten-free options, much to the joy of Shari).

 

The staff is relaxed, but not in the sense that on a rushed morning you’ll be forced to wait around as they putter along to make your order. No, they are simply obliging and well versed when it comes to running the café.

 

As for the cafés environment, there is ample lighting as well as table seating and couch seating. Just behind the café is a little cove of patio seating shaded by palm trees. Other than the little palm seeds that like to drop down and pelt you every so often, the patio is really quite nice being so tucked away and tranquil.

 

Overall, Fair Trade Café is a coffee spot with all the goods. The coffee is tasty, and moderately priced. The service is warm and the seating is nice. Additionally, on days when you cannot make it out to Fair Trade’s main café, you can get your fix at their second location at Civic Space Park.
